CF34E Collisions

Description

On a number line there are $ n $ balls. At time moment $ 0 $ for each ball the following data is known: its coordinate $ x_{i} $ , speed $ v_{i} $ (possibly, negative) and weight $ m_{i} $ . The radius of the balls can be ignored. The balls collide elastically, i.e. if two balls weighing $ m_{1} $ and $ m_{2} $ and with speeds $ v_{1} $ and $ v_{2} $ collide, their new speeds will be: ![](https://cdn.luogu.com.cn/upload/vjudge_pic/CF34E/939b5bce3bf45a602cb8d3e9f25a3ee89c788ac0.png).Your task is to find out, where each ball will be $ t $ seconds after.
